Cos(Number)
Returns the trigonometric cosine of an angle
ACos(Number)
Returns the arc cosine of a value
Cosh(Number)
Returns the hyperbolic cosine of a double value
Sin(Number)
Returns the trigonometric sine of an angle
ASin(Number)
Returns the arc sine of a value
Sinh(Number)
Returns the hyperbolic sine of a double value
Tan(Number)
Returns the trigonometric tangent of an angle
ATan(Number)
Returns the arc tangent of a value
ATan2(Number, Number)
Returns the angle theta from the conversion of rectangular coordinates (x, y) to polar coordinates (r, theta)
Tanh(Number)
Returns the hyperbolic tangent of a double value
Abs(Number)
Returns the absolute value of a value
Sign(Number)
Returns the signum function of the argument
Sqrt(Number)
Returns the square root of a value
Ceil(Number)
Returns the smallest value that is greater than or equal to the argument and is equal to a mathematical integer.
Floor(Number)
Returns the largest value that is less than or equal to the argument and is equal to a mathematical integer.
Round(Number)
Returns the closest number to the argument, with ties rounding up
Log(Number)
Returns the natural logarithm (base e) of a double value
Exp(Number)
Returns Euler's number e raised to the power of a double value
PI()
Returns the double value that is closer than any other to pi.
E()
Returns the double value that is closer than any other to e
isNaN(Object)
Checks whether the given object is not a number
ToRadians(Number)
Converts an angle measured in degrees to an equivalent angle measured in radians.
ToDegrees(Number)
Converts an angle measured in radians to an equivalent angle measured in degrees.
